Learning Objectives
At the conclusion of this activity, participants will be able to:
- Assess the value of robotics in the treatment of patients requiring coronary surgery;
- State how to apply techniques of endoscopic coronary anastomosis on a beating heart;
- Describe the significance of technological advances and device development in improving surgical outcomes;
- Identify the role of TECAB as a component of hybrid coronary interventions;
- Discuss how to apply anesthetic considerations in robotic coronary surgery.

Disclosure Declarations
As a provider accredited by the ACCME, The University of Chicago Pritzker School of Medicine asks everyone who is in a position to control the content of an education activity to disclose all relevant financial relationships with any commercial interest. This includes any entity producing, marketing, re-selling, or distributing health care goods or services consumed by or used on patients. The ACCME defines “relevant financial relationships” as financial relationships in any amount occurring within the past 12 months, including financial relationships of a spouse or life partner that could create a conflict of interest. Mechanisms are in place to identify and resolve any potential conflict of interest prior to the start of the activity.
Additionally, The University of Chicago Pritzker School of Medicine requires authors to identify investigational products or off-label uses of products regulated by the US Food and Drug Administration, at first mention and where appropriate in the content.
